Description of Work Proposed
Please type or punt clearly.Attach additional sheets, as necessaly.
The proposed project is to protect and preserve the weather envelope of the library by conducting the ordinary
maintenance of repairing or replacing the exterior wood surrounding the windows of the library that have
deteriorated from age and weather. The work does not involve a change in design, material, color, or outward
appearance of the structure. The CPA awarded the Library a grant for the project in FYI 6.
The project was designed by the Library's architect,Robert Farley, and consists of restoring select Library window
sills, wood window jambs, and wood window trim mouldings to good condition, utilizing repairs or replacements.
Western Red Cedar or Mahogany wood will be used, depending upon availability. When new wood elements are
installed,back priming of all surfaces will be done prior to installation. All exterior mouldings and exterior wood
surfaces will receive new paint finishes: 1 coat of approved primer and 2 coats of approved finish coats of green
color to match the original finish.
